Overview
Blanc Du Soleil is a new Pierce's Disease (PD) tolerant white wine grape cultivar that was bred by Florida A&M University in 1999. It resulted from a cross between Stover and Blanc Du Bois, two interspecific PD-tolerant hybrids that were developed in Florida. Blanc Du Soleil was cooperatively released by Florida A&M University and Texas A&M University in 2022. (2 pages)
